Q: Is 21,436,636 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 21,436,636 is not a prime number.

Why is 21,436,636 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 21436636 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 13 19 26 38 52 76 169 247 338 494 676 988 1,669 3,211 3,338 6,422 6,676 12,844 21,697 31,711 43,394 63,422 86,788 126,844 282,061 412,243 564,122 824,486 1,128,244 1,648,972 5,359,159 10,718,318 and 21,436,636, with no remainder.

Since 21,436,636 cannot be divided by just 1 and 21,436,636, it is not a prime number.
